NVIDIA (NASDAQ: NVDA) is a global technology company renowned for inventing the GPU (Graphics Processing Unit) in 1999, which has redefined modern computer graphics and revolutionized parallel computing. More recently, GPU deep learning ignited modern AI — the next era of computing — with the GPU acting as the brain of computers, robots, and self-driving cars that can perceive and understand the world. NVIDIA is now a full-stack computing company with data-center-scale offerings that are reshaping industry. The company's work in AI, high-performance computing, and gaming is transforming trillion-dollar industries like healthcare, transportation, and manufacturing.

Address: 11601 Alterra Pkwy, Austin, TX 78758, USA
Taps into Austin's burgeoning tech talent pool and innovation ecosystem. Supports key R&D initiatives and business unit operations within the central United States, contributing to NVIDIA's diverse product portfolio.
Address: Bldg. 10, Gav-Yam Park, PO Box 150, Yokneam 2069200, Israel
Serves as NVIDIA's primary hub for advanced networking R&D, capitalizing on Israel's renowned expertise in deep technology and cybersecurity. Essential for developing components for supercomputers and large-scale AI clusters.
Address: 8F, No. 188, Sec. 5, Zhongxiao E. Rd., Xinyi Dist., Taipei City 110, Taiwan
Strategic location due to its proximity to major semiconductor foundries, manufacturing partners, and the broader Asian tech ecosystem. Crucial for NVIDIA's global operations and market penetration in APAC.
Address: Bagmane Tech Park, C V Raman Nagar, Bangalore, Karnataka 560093, India
Leverages India's vast pool of skilled software engineers and IT professionals. Supports global R&D efforts and plays a crucial role in the development and optimization of NVIDIA's software ecosystem.

NVIDIA Newsroom • March 18, 2024
NVIDIA today unveiled its next-generation AI graphics processing unit (GPU) architecture, codenamed Blackwell. The new platform promises order-of-magnitude performance leaps for training and inference of large language models and complex AI workloads, setting new standards for accelerated computing....more
NVIDIA Investor Relations • February 21, 2024
NVIDIA reported record quarterly revenue of $22.1 billion, up 22% from Q3 and up 265% from a year ago. Record full-year revenue of $60.9 billion, up 126%. This surge was primarily driven by its Data Center segment, fueled by demand for Hopper architecture AI chips....more
NVIDIA Blog • January 8, 2024
At CES 2024, NVIDIA introduced the GeForce RTX 4080 SUPER, RTX 4070 Ti SUPER, and RTX 4070 SUPER graphics cards, offering significant performance upgrades for PC gamers and content creators, along with enhanced AI capabilities for consumer PCs....more
NVIDIA Newsroom • May 29, 2023
NVIDIA announced the DGX GH200 AI supercomputer, featuring the NVIDIA Grace Hopper Superchip, designed to power giant AI models and usher in a new era of exascale AI. This system dramatically increases memory capacity for AI and HPC workloads....more
